Do you need a car in Fall River, MA?

Having a car in Fall River, MA, can make commuting easier and more convenient. Many job opportunities are spread out, and public transportation options may be limited. A car provides flexibility and can save time, making it a valuable asset for job seekers.


In Fall River, the availability of jobs varies by industry and location. Some areas have better public transport links, but owning a car often helps in reaching more job opportunities. It allows for a broader search and quicker access to interviews, giving job seekers a competitive edge.

Fall River, MA, offers various transportation options for residents and job seekers. Many people find that owning a car is beneficial for commuting. The city's layout and distance between locations make driving a convenient choice. However, public transportation is also available. The Southeastern Regional Transit Authority (SRTA) provides bus services that cover many areas in and around Fall River.

Weather can impact transportation choices in Fall River. During winter, snow and ice can make driving challenging. In such cases, public transportation or walking might be safer. Fall River's public buses are equipped to handle winter conditions, offering a reliable alternative. For those who prefer not to drive, biking is another option. The city has bike lanes and paths that make cycling a viable choice, especially in good weather.

Overall, while a car can be helpful, it is not always necessary in Fall River. Public transportation, biking, and walking are all practical options. Job seekers should consider their specific needs and the weather when deciding on the best way to commute.

What is the job market like in Fall River, MA?

The job market in Fall River, MA, offers a mix of opportunities for job seekers. The city has a diverse economy with key industries such as healthcare, manufacturing, and education. These sectors provide a range of positions for those looking to start or advance their careers. The local economy also benefits from nearby businesses and industries in the greater New England area, offering additional job prospects.

Fall River's job market sees steady demand for skilled workers. Many employers seek candidates with specific skills and experience. For instance, healthcare professionals, including nurses and medical technicians, are in high demand. Similarly, those with expertise in manufacturing and logistics find many opportunities. Job seekers with education backgrounds, such as teachers and administrators, also have good prospects. The city’s commitment to supporting local businesses helps create a stable job market.
